About This Automation

Parts ordering for vehicle repairs requires checking stock, comparing supplier pricing, creating a purchase order, and following up until the part arrives. Doing this by phone, email, and spreadsheet creates delays, duplicate calls, and missed follow-ups that stall repairs.

An automated version checks inventory and supplier options at once, generates the order, and tracks delivery status without manual chasing. Parts arrive faster, stockouts drop, and technicians spend less time waiting on updates.

How The Automation Works

The full workflow, from trigger to completion.

1. Technician Submits Part Requesttrigger

Technician sends a message requesting a part, which starts the workflow automatically.

2. Parts Sourcing Finds Best Price

Checks current stock and supplier pricing history to recommend the best source and lead time.

3. Create Purchase Order

Purchase order is drafted and logged automatically once the recommended supplier is selected.

4. Send Order

Order confirmation email is sent to the chosen supplier without manual drafting.

5. Service Advisor Calls Supplier To Confirm

If the supplier does not confirm within the expected window, the advisor is prompted to call and confirm manually.

6. Order Tracking Monitors Delivery

Watches for confirmation emails and shipping updates, keeping the expected delivery date current.

7. Update Inventory

Stock counts adjust automatically once the shipment is confirmed as received and verified.

8. Notify Technician

Technician receives an automatic alert the moment the part is in stock and ready for pickup.
